1. Scrum是一种敏捷项目管理框架,其核心理念是()。
A. 计划性 B. 适应性 C. 确定性 D. 顺序性
2. Scrum框架起源于()。
A. 传统项目管理系统 B. 软件开发方法论 C. 敏捷软件开发方法 D. 面向对象编程
3. Scrum的目的是()。
A. 提高开发效率 B. 降低软件开发成本 C. 提高客户满意度 D. 以上全部
4. Scrum框架的价值在于()。
A. 能快速响应市场变化 B. 能有效提高产品质量 C. 能降低开发成本 D. 以上全部
5. Scrum框架中,产品所有权的角色是()。
A. Scrum Master B. 开发团队成员 C. 利益相关者 D. 项目经理
6. 在Scrum框架中,以下是哪个过程用于对已完成的 Sprint 进行评估和总结?
A. Sprint Planning B. Daily Stand-up C. Sprint Review D. Sprint Retrospective
7. Scrum框架中,Sprint Review 会议的目的是()。
A. 展示已完成的工作成果 B. 获得客户批准 C. 收集反馈并进行改进 D. 评估团队的绩效
8. Scrum框架中,以下哪个 artifacts 是在 Sprint 期间创建和更新的?
A. Product Backlog B. Sprint Backlog C. Increment D. User Story
9. Scrum框架中,以下哪项被认为是 Scrum 的核心支柱之一?
A. 过程方法 B. 迭代开发 C. 持续集成 D. 敏捷性
10. Scrum框架适用于各种规模的项目吗?()
A. 是 B. 否
11. Scrum框架中有几种角色,它们分别是()。
A. Scrum Master B. 产品所有权者 C. 开发团队领导 D. Scrum咨询师
12. Scrum Master 的主要职责是()。
A. 确保 Scrum 流程的执行 B. 管理产品 backlog C. 协调利益相关者需求 D. 监督团队成员工作
13. Scrum 框架中,下列哪个角色负责确保团队按时完成 Sprint 任务?
A. Scrum Master B. Product Owner C. Development Team D. Project Manager
14. Scrum 框架中,Product Owner 的主要职责是()。
A. 负责产品的需求分析和规格说明 B. 负责项目的进度和质量控制 C. 负责与客户的沟通和需求变更管理 D. 负责管理团队的日常工作和资源分配
15. Scrum 框架中,开发团队成员的职责包括()。
A. 负责产品的开发和测试工作 B. 负责项目的进度和质量控制 C. 负责与客户的沟通和需求变更管理 D. 负责管理团队的日常工作和资源分配
16. Scrum 框架中,Sprint Planning 会议的参与者包括()。
A. Scrum Master B. Product Owner C. Development Team D. 利益相关者
17. Scrum 框架中,Sprint Review 会议的参与者包括()。
A. Scrum Master B. Product Owner C. Development Team D. 利益相关者
18. Scrum 框架中,Sprint Retrospective 会议的目的是()。
A. 对已完成的工作进行评估和总结 B. 监督团队成员的工作 C. 分析项目风险和问题 D. 决定项目资源和预算分配
19. Scrum 框架中,Scrum Master 和 Product Owner 应该由()来担任。
A. 同一人 B. 不同人 C. Scrum Master 可以由 anyone 担任,而 Product Owner 必须由业务专家或客户代表来担任 D. Scrum Master 和 Product Owner 都是由 same 个人担任
20. Scrum 框架中,以下哪些事件是 Scrum 框架的核心事件?
A. Sprint Planning B. Daily Stand-up C. Sprint Review D. Sprint Retrospective
21. Scrum 框架中,Sprint Planning 会议的主要目的是()。
A. 确定项目的范围和进度 B. 确定产品的需求和规格 C. 分配任务和资源 D. 获得客户的批准
22. Scrum 框架中,以下哪些活动是在 Daily Stand-up 会议中进行的?
A. 讨论项目的进度和问题 B. 分享客户反馈和需求变更 C. 确定下一天的任务和工作优先级 D. 汇报项目的质量和进度
23. Scrum 框架中,Sprint Review 会议的目的是()。
A. 确定项目的范围和进度 B. 确定产品的需求和规格 C. 分配任务和资源 D. 获得客户的批准
24. Scrum 框架中,Sprint Retrospective 会议的主要目的是()。
A. 总结和学习 B. 评估和改进 C. 确定项目的范围和进度 D. 确定产品的需求和规格
25. Scrum 框架中,以下哪些活动是在 Sprint Review 会议中进行的?
A. 展示已完成的工作成果 B. 获得客户的批准 C. 讨论项目的问题和风险 D. 确定下一天的任务和工作优先级
26. Scrum 框架中,Scrum Master 可以在 Daily Stand-up 会议上代替 Product Owner 吗?
A. 当然可以 B. 不可以 C. 取决于具体情况 D. 需要事先征得 Product Owner 的同意
27. Scrum 框架中,Scrum Master 可以在 Sprint Review 会议上代替 Product Owner 吗?
A. 当然可以 B. 不可以 C. 取决于具体情况 D. 需要事先征得 Product Owner 的同意
28. Scrum 框架中,以下哪些是 Scrum artifact?
A. Product Backlog B. Sprints Backlog C. Increment D. User Story
29. Scrum 框架中,Product Backlog 是什么?
A. 一份详细的产品需求文档 B. 一份包含所有用户故事的文档 C. 一份记录项目进度的文档 D. 一份由利益相关者签署的文档
30. Scrum 框架中,Sprints Backlog 是什么?
A. 一份详细的使用者故事列表 B. 一份记录项目进度的文档 C. 一份由利益相关者签署的文档 D. 一份包含所有用户故事的文档
31. Scrum 框架中,Increment 是什么?
A. 一种敏捷项目管理方法 B. 一种软件开发技术 C. 一种项目管理工具 D. 一种敏捷开发方法
32. Scrum 框架中,User Story 是什么?
A. 一种敏捷项目管理方法 B. 一种软件开发技术 C. 一种项目管理工具 D. 一种敏捷开发方法
33. Scrum 框架中,Scrum artifact 的目的是什么?
A. 帮助团队更好地管理项目进度和进度 B. 帮助团队更好地理解客户需求 C. 帮助团队更好地协作和沟通 D. 帮助团队更好地完成项目任务
34. Scrum 框架中,Scrum artifact 是通过什么方式进行管理的?
A. 通过会议和站立会议进行管理 B. 通过项目管理工具进行管理 C. 通过文档进行管理 D. 通过电子邮件进行管理
35. Scrum 框架中,如何保证 Scrum artifact 的完整性和一致性?
A. 定期进行版本控制 B. 建立严格的审核流程 C. 使用敏捷项目管理工具 D. 建立清晰的命名规范
36. Scrum 框架被广泛应用于哪种类型的项目中?
A. 软件开发项目 B. 产品开发项目 C. 项目管理项目 D. 所有上述项目
37. Scrum 框架最初是为了解决什么问题而发明的?
A. 提高软件开发效率 B. 降低软件开发成本 C. 提高项目管理效率 D. 以上全部
38. Scrum 框架被认为是一种哪种管理方法?
A. 传统的瀑布式管理方法 B. 敏捷式的管理方法 C. 面向对象的管理方法 D. 所有的管理方法
39. Scrum 框架中的“Scrum”一词来源于什么?
A. 敏捷 B. 可见 C. 回应 D. 转型
40. Scrum 框架中,以下哪个概念是 central to the Scrum framework?
A. Time-boxing B. Continuous delivery C. Prescriptive processes D. Flexibility
41. Scrum 框架中,Scrum Master 的作用类似于()。
A. 项目经理 B. 产品负责人 C. 开发人员 D. 一切
42. Scrum 框架中,下面哪项不属于 Scrum 艺术?
A. 透明度 B. 变化 C. 自主性 D. 控制
43. Scrum 框架中,下面哪项是一个 Scrum 过程?
A. Sprint planning B. Daily stand-up C. Sprint review D. All of the above
44. Scrum 框架中,Sprint 是什么?
A. 时间段 B. 阶段 C. 过程 D. 活动
45. Scrum 框架中,Scrum Team 是由哪些人组成的?
A. 开发人员 B. 产品负责人 C. Scrum Master D. 所有上述人员
46. Scrum 框架最适合哪种组织结构?
A. 功能式组织结构 B. project-based组织结构 C. 流程式组织结构 D. 混合型组织结构
47. Scrum 框架中的 Scrum Master 是由谁担任的?
A. 项目经理 B. 产品负责人 C. 开发团队领导 D. 所有上述人员
48. Scrum 框架中,产品所有权是谁的责任?
A. Scrum Master B. 项目团队 C. 利益相关者 D. 所有人
49. Scrum 框架中,Scrum Master 的主要职责是什么?
A. 管理项目进度和质量 B. 协调利益相关者和开发团队 C. 负责敏捷项目管理方法的设计和实施 D. 以上所述
50. Scrum 框架中,Scrum Team 包括哪些角色?
A. Scrum Master, Product Owner, 开发人员和测试人员 B. Scrum Master, Product Owner, 开发人员 C. Scrum Master, 项目经理, 开发人员和测试人员 D. 以上所述
51. Scrum 框架中,Sprint Planning 会议的参与者包括哪些人?
A. Scrum Master, Product Owner, 开发人员和测试人员 B. Scrum Master, Product Owner C. Scrum Master, 开发团队领导和利益相关者 D. 以上所述
52. Scrum 框架中,Daily Stand-up 会议的目的是什么?
A. 共享进展和解决问题 B. 评估项目进度和质量 C. 确定问题和风险 D. 监控项目状态
53. Scrum 框架中,Sprint Review 会议的目的是什么?
A. 展示已完成的工作成果 B. 获得客户的批准 C. 讨论项目的问题和风险 D. 确定下一天的任务和工作优先级
54. Scrum 框架中,Sprint Retrospective 会议的目的是什么?
A. 总结经验教训 B. 评估项目进度和质量 C. 确定问题和风险 D. 确定下一天的任务和工作优先级
55. Scrum 框架中,Scrum Artifacts 包括哪些内容?
A. 项目计划 B. 项目进度报告 C. 用户故事文档 D. 以上所述二、问答题
1. 什么是Scrum?
2. Scrum的目的是什么?
3. Scrum有哪些价值?
4. Scrum中有哪些角色?
5. Scrum中的sprint是什么?
6. Scrum中的每日站会有什么内容?
7. Scrum中的sprint review有什么作用?
8. Scrum中的sprinte回顾是什么?
9. Scrum中的产品backlog和Sprint backlog有何区别?
10. Scrum在大型项目中有什么优势?
参考答案
选择题:
1. B 2. C 3. D 4. D 5. C 6. D 7. A 8. AB 9. D 10. A
11. ACB 12. A 13. C 14. A 15. A 16. D 17. D 18. A 19. C 20. ACD
21. B 22. AC 23. D 24. B 25. AB 26. ABCD 27. ABCD 28. ABD 29. A 30. A
31. D 32. D 33. C 34. A 35. AB 36. D 37. D 38. B 39. A 40. D
41. B 42. D 43. D 44. D 45. D 46. B 47. D 48. C 49. D 50. A
51. A 52. A 53. D 54. A 55. C
问答题:
1. 什么是Scrum?
Scrum是一种敏捷项目管理框架,用于解决传统项目管理的缺陷,如低效率、长期规划和版本控制等问题。它强调的是快速反馈、迭代开发和持续交付。
思路
:首先解释Scrum的概念,然后阐述其优点。
2. Scrum的目的是什么?
Scrum的目的是提高项目的灵活性和效率,通过持续的迭代开发,快速响应需求变化,最终实现高质量的产品。
思路
:明确目的,回答为什么采用Scrum。
3. Scrum有哪些价值?
Scrum有四大价值:提高项目的灵活性、提高团队的协作效率、促进产品质量和降低成本。
思路
:列举价值,并结合实际应用进行说明。
4. Scrum中有哪些角色?
Scrum中有四个角色:产品所有者、Scrum大师、开发团队和利益相关者。每个角色都有特定的职责和责任。
思路
:列举角色并简要介绍各自的职责。
5. Scrum中的sprint是什么?
sprint是Scrum中的一个重要概念,表示一个迭代周期,通常为两周,期间团队成员完成特定任务并交付产品的一部分。
思路
:解释sprint的概念,并阐述其在Scrum中的重要性。
6. Scrum中的每日站会有什么内容?
Scrum中的每日站会是一个短暂的会议,团队成员分享进展、解决问题、计划下一阶段工作等。
思路
:描述每日站会的内容和目标。
7. Scrum中的sprint review有什么作用?
Scrum中的sprint review是为了展示已完成的工作,获得客户或利益相关者的验收,并确定下一步的工作计划。
思路
:阐述sprint review的作用和目的。
8. Scrum中的sprinte回顾是什么?
Scrum中的sprinte回顾是一个反思和总结的过程,团队成员一起讨论如何改进工作流程和提高工作效率。
思路
:描述sprinte回顾的过程和目的。
9. Scrum中的产品backlog和Sprint backlog有何区别?
产品backlog是整个项目的产品需求列表,而Sprint backlog是在当前sprint中需要完成的任务列表。
思路
:解释两者之间的区别和联系。
10. Scrum在大型项目中有什么优势?
Scrum适合于各种规模的项目,特别是大型项目,因为它可以有效地管理复杂性,提高团队的合作效率,并及时调整计划。
思路
:分析Scrum在大型项目中的优势和应用场景。